A pass means no significant violations. A conditional pass means an issue was found and the restaurant was given time to correct it. A closed result means the inspector ordered the place to stop serving customers.

Mechanical dishwashing: Wash / rinse water clean, water temperature, timing cycles, sanitizer / Chlorine sanitizer concentration must be at least 100 parts per million at 24°C or greater for at least 45 seconds
